QA 15 — Buffer Transitions & HiDPI

How to run

emacs --no-init-file -l qa/15-transitions/test.el
EMACS_GPU_DISABLE=1 emacs --no-init-file -l qa/15-transitions/test.el

HiDPI tests are macOS-only (Retina display required).

Checklist — Buffer transitions

TODO 15.1 Crossfade — previous buffer fades out

Press t to cycle between buffers with crossfade enabled. The previous buffer content must fade out smoothly as the new one appears. Failure: hard cut (no fade), or the fade shows garbled intermediate frames.

TODO 15.2 Crossfade duration — matches configured value

(setq gpu-buffer-transition-duration 0.5) should produce a 0.5s fade. Failure: fade is instantaneous or takes much longer than configured.

TODO 15.3 No residue after fade completes

After the crossfade finishes, the new buffer must appear perfectly clean. Failure: faint traces of the previous buffer remain after the fade ends.

TODO 15.4 Pump cadence during fade — 60Hz, smooth

The fade must be smooth (not choppy). At 0.5s duration it should produce ~30 intermediate frames. Failure: visible frame-rate drops during the fade; choppy animation.

TODO 15.5 No crossfade when disabled

(setq gpu-buffer-transitions nil) Pressing t must produce an instant hard cut with no fade. Failure: fade still occurs after disabling.

Checklist — HiDPI (macOS Retina only)

TODO 15.6 [macOS] Capture size is 2× the logical frame size

(gpu-capture-frame "/tmp/qa-capture.png") Open the PNG and verify its pixel dimensions are exactly 2× the Emacs frame's logical pixel width and height. Failure: capture is 1× size (not Retina-aware).

TODO 15.7 [macOS] Glyph sharpness — per-physical-pixel AA

Zoom into the capture at 6× (pixel viewer or Preview zoom). Each glyph must show antialiasing on individual physical pixels. Failure: glyphs appear as upscaled 1× bitmaps (blocky edges).

TODO 15.8 [macOS] NS vs Metal parity at 2×

Compare a Metal capture with a NS capture (EMACS_GPU_DISABLE=1). Acceptable: fuzz5% ~0.5%, fuzz20% ~0.05% (AA on glyph edges only). Failure: large structural differences (wrong colors, misaligned text).
